Portable Pipe Beveling Tools for On Site Pile Fabrication in Marine Projects

Marine construction projects often require pipe and pile fabrication directly at the jobsite. When piles must be cut, aligned and welded on barges, piers or temporary platforms, relying on shop-based preparation introduces delays that can affect both schedule and cost. Portable beveling tools allow crews to machine weld preparations on location, improving precision and reducing transport needs. This approach supports better workflow, fewer bottlenecks and more consistent weld quality in demanding marine environments.
Importance of On Site Beveling
Logistics and Scheduling Advantages
Pile fabrication in marine settings often involves tight working windows shaped by tides, weather and vessel availability. Moving large steel piles or tubular members between a fabrication yard and the work platform is time intensive. On site beveling eliminates those moves. Portable units clamp directly to the pipe, allowing machining steps to begin immediately after cutting and alignment. This speeds up project cycles and helps marine contractors stay on track.
Improved Weld Quality
Marine piles experience dynamic forces from waves, currents and vessel impacts. Joint integrity is central to structure longevity. Preparing weld ends on site allows crews to check alignment and fit up in real time. The ability to bevel, face and clean the joint at the point of assembly supports more consistent geometry, better penetration and fewer defects. Many field beveling systems are designed to minimize vibration while providing stable cut geometry for heavy wall sections used in marine foundations.
Key Features of Portable Beveling Tools
Adaptable Mounting Systems
Portable beveling tools commonly use internal mandrels or expandable clamping systems that lock inside the pipe. This design is ideal for marine projects where external fixtures may be impractical. Internal clamping ensures stability even when working at height or on a moving barge. Working ranges typically cover common pile sizes found in waterfront construction, including several inches of diameter adjustment per machine.
Lightweight Construction
Field fabrication teams benefit from compact equipment that one operator can position and secure without support machinery. Portable bevelers are made with lightweight metal housings and compact drives suited for confined working decks, scaffolding or temporary platforms. This improves safety and reduces the time needed to reposition equipment between cuts.
Multi Process Machining
Marine piles often require more than a simple bevel. Depending on weld procedure, crews may need a compound bevel, a facing pass or a counterbore. Many portable systems offer tool heads that can produce V preps, J preps or compound angles from a single mounting position. This versatility allows operators to handle both primary fabrication and corrective adjustments without changing machines.
Suitable for Marine Grade Materials
Marine work regularly involves high strength steels, stainless alloys and corrosion resistant materials. Portable beveling tools designed for field use typically accommodate these metals when fitted with the correct cutting inserts. The ability to handle harder alloys is essential when preparing piles exposed to saltwater environments.

Applications in Marine Pile Fabrication
Deck Level Preparation
Many marine piles are assembled and welded on a laydown deck before driving. Portable beveling tools allow workers to prepare weld edges right where piles are being aligned. This supports faster assembly of segments, sleeves or splices used in longer pile installations.
Tight Access and Confined Space Work
Cofferdams, platforms and temporary supports often provide limited room for equipment. Portable beveling tools excel in these restricted spaces because they install internally and require minimal clearance. Their mobility makes them suitable for emergent repairs or final adjustments close to the waterline.
Rework and Inspection Support
Marine projects require frequent inspections throughout installation. If a bevel or weld prep does not meet specification, portable tools allow corrective machining immediately on site. This prevents costly rehandling of piles and minimizes disruption to the installation sequence.
Choosing the Right Portable Beveling Tool
Match to Diameter and Wall Thickness
Selection begins with matching the operating range to the pile dimensions. Marine piles vary significantly, and the chosen tool must support the outer diameter and wall thickness of each section. Ensuring the tool has clearance for heavy wall pipe is essential for working with structural piles.
Consider Drive Type
Marine locations may have limited electrical access or require pneumatically powered tools. Many portable bevelers are available with both electrical and air motor configurations. The correct choice depends on jobsite power availability, safety requirements and the working environment.
Prioritize Setup Speed
Since tidal windows and weather directly influence marine construction schedules, setup speed is important. Portable tools with self centering systems, rapid tool changes and simple mounting help crews move efficiently from one section to the next. Reducing time between cuts supports smoother workflow.
Evaluate Surface Finish Requirements
Weld quality depends on clean, consistent bevels. When selecting a tool, crews should consider the required bevel angle tolerance, surface finish and root face dimensions specified in the weld procedure. Tools that provide stable, repeatable machining help ensure uniform weld preparations.

Best Practices in Operation
On site beveling should occur as close as possible to the alignment and fit up zone to reduce handling. Operators should maintain stable footing and secure lines when working over water. Pipe ends should be cleaned before and after machining to remove debris that may affect weld integrity. Cutting inserts should be replaced at the first sign of dullness to maintain consistent surface geometry. Regular inspection of equipment and proper lubrication help extend tool life in corrosive marine environments.
